Cardiovascular Information Systems (CVIS) enhance workflow efficiency, provide real-time patient data access, and support advanced analytics for better clinical decision-making in hospitals and cardiac care centers.
The cardiovascular system comprises the blood vessels and heart and It carries nutrients and oxygen to other parts of the body and removes carbon dioxide from them. Cardiovascular information system enlightened database system maintained by a cardiologist (specially trained medical professionals in heart-related treatments) used to manage the data of patient treatment programs, the enormous images files like 2D echo, ECG and MRI, etc, treatment summaries and results created during the course of treatment and diagnosis. This CVIS is a special kind of Electronic health record used in cardiology to streamline patient care, improves employee work accuracy, better communications with referred doctors, and image/ cardiology asset accessibility.
